Meanwhile, what is your suggestion regarding the patchset. I've seen David has sent Linus a pull request for 4.4-rc1 that includes it. Should we send a revert for rockchip commit and then patch later the function?
It definitely needs to be fixed, and I'd suggest its early enough in the -rc cycle (which hasn't begun yet) to simply fix drm_of_component_probe() to take two compare functions.
I still don't have a Rockchip board to test the patch, so I need to find out someone willing to test them. Mark?
I'd also suggest at this point another change: please rename it to drm_of_kms_component_probe() since this is only a generic case for KMS drivers. GPU DRM drivers need something different.
